(12 February 1918 - 16 July 1994)
In the post-quantum-mechanics era, few physicists, if any, have matched Julian Schwinger in contributions to and influence on the development of physics.
A towering giant in theoretical physics, Schwinger left his indelible mark on diverse fields such as quantum mechanics, quantum field theory, electrodynamics, nuclear physics, statistical mechanics, atomic physics, elementary particle physics, gravity, and mathematical physics.
He shared the Nobel Prize in Physics 1965 with Sin-Itiro Tomonaga and Richard P. Feynman for "their fundamental work in quantum electrodynamics, with deep-ploughing consequences for the physics of elementary particles".
